JUDGMENT

(Judgment of the Court was delivered by Chaitali Chatterjee (Das) J.)

1. This instant criminal appeal has been filed under Section 374(2) of the Code of Criminal

Procedure against the judgment and order dated 7th September, 1990 passed by learned Special Judge, E.C. Act cum Additional District & Sessions Judge, Midnapore arising out of Jhargram P.S. Case No.13 dated 13th September, 1988 under Section 7(1)(a)(ii) of the Act X of 1955 whereby the accused/appellant and three others were convicted of the

Essential Commodities Act.

2. In this case, Mr. Aniruddha Bhattacharyya, learned advocate has been appointed as

Amicus Curiae.

3. Heard the submission of both the learned counsel appearing for the parties and

perused the materials on record.
